How safe is Girton?
Girton has a very low crime rate of 39.0 crimes per 1,000 people, making it one of the safest areas.
What are the best schools in Girton?
Girton has 13 schools nearby. The top-rated Ofsted Outstanding schools include Histon and Impington Brook Primary School, Chesterton Community College, University of Cambridge Primary School. Other well-regarded schools rated Good by Ofsted include North Cambridge Academy and The Grove Primary School. Note: 1 school is currently rated as Requires Improvement.
What are the demographics of Girton?
The majority of residents in Girton identify as White (British) (79%). Most residents were born in the United Kingdom (83%). The area has a mix of religious beliefs with no single faith forming a majority.
